Manage Privacy Settings
Google Account allows users to manage their privacy settings to control what personal information is shared and with whom. Here are a few key aspects of managing privacy settings:
- Privacy Policy: Google’s Privacy Policy outlines how Google collects, uses, and shares user information, as well as the privacy rights users have with respect to their information.
- Account privacy settings: Users can access their Google Account privacy settings to control what information is shared with Google, and adjust these settings as needed.
- Activity controls: Users can adjust activity controls to determine what data is saved to their Google Account and what is used to personalize their experience across different Google services. For example, users can choose to pause location history or disable voice and audio activity.
- Security and login: Users can enable two-factor authentication and manage their password security to keep their account information safe and secure.
- Ad personalization: Google provides options for controlling ad personalization, such as adjusting ad settings, opting out of personalized ads, or controlling how Google uses data from their activity to personalize ads.
By managing privacy settings, users can control how their personal information is shared and used, and ensure a secure and personalized experience across all Google services. This helps to protect their privacy and maintain control over their data.

Security Features
Google Account provides a range of security features to help protect users’ personal information and account data. Some of the key security features include:
- Two-factor authentication: Google offers two-factor authentication as an extra layer of security, requiring users to enter a code from their phone in addition to their password when signing in.
- Device management: Google allows users to manage the devices that are connected to their account, including viewing device information and location data, and revoking access from lost or stolen devices.
- Data encryption: Google uses encryption to protect users’ data, both in transit and at rest. This helps to keep their information safe and secure, even if their account is compromised.
- Security alerts: Google sends security alerts to users to notify them of any suspicious activity on their account, such as sign-ins from unfamiliar devices or locations.
- Spam and malware protection: Google uses advanced filters to detect and block spam and malware, helping to keep users’ inboxes clean and their accounts secure.
By providing these security features, Google helps to ensure that users’ personal information and account data are protected and secure, even in the face of potential threats like hacking, phishing, and malware.
